When Will mocks Sean’s dead wife to get a reaction, Sean corners him. "You're just a kid," he says. "You have no idea what you're talking about." He then explains that while Will can read about history in books, he has never known the smell of a battlefield. He can read about Michelangelo, but he doesn't know the ache of a woman’s soul. At the time, Damon and Affleck were struggling actors sharing a apartment in Los Angeles. They conceived the idea of a "brainiac" from the rough neighborhoods of Boston—a kid who could solve math problems that baffle geniuses but couldn't solve the riddle of his own self-worth.
